The Gold Buffalo Coin was the first 24k gold coin produced by the US Mint and introduced to the bullion market in 2006.

The coin weighs 1 Troy oz of 99.99% pure gold, and the design reflects the nation’s heritage through the inspired James Earl Fraser’s Indian Head design, which dates back to 1913.

These coins pay tribute to the pivotal role of the 40th US President Ronald Reagan in American coinage history. They are encapsulated with an exclusive label featuring his portrait and signature.

Reagan fiercely advocated for coin collecting and bullion investing. He signed the Liberty Coin Act of 1985 and the Bullion Coin Act of 1985, which grounded the production of American Eagle Coins, and issued a Presidential Proclamation during his government, making the week of April 17 "National Coin Week."

The Design

The obverse features James Earl Fraser’s inspired Native American Chief design. It consists of a right-profile bust that combines traces from Native American tribes: the Big Tree, the Iron Tail, and the Two Moons. 

The inscriptions “LIBERTY” in front of the Native’s forehead, the year of mintage, and an “F,” referring to the artist’s initials, complete the image.

The giant American Bison on the reverse has an upstanding depiction on the left side, covering most of the surface, resembling a Buffalo. Hence, the coin’s moniker.

The engravings on the design read “UNITED STATES OF AMERICA,” “E PLURIBUS UNUM,” “IN GOD WE TRUST,” “$50,” and “1 OZ .9999 FINE GOLD,” referring to the coin’s denomination, weight, fineness, and metal content.

An NGC MS-70 First Day of Issue coin 

Coin grading services like NGC - Numismatic Guaranty Company appraise and grade coins using the Sheldon Scale, which ranges from 1 to 70, depending on their condition.

MS means Mint State, referring to coins fabricated with the same shape as a popular business coin that remained uncirculated. 70, the highest grade on the scale, is for a coin that shows no visible flaws.

“First Day of Issue,” according to NGC, is a coin purchased from the US Mint on the very first day it was made publicly available.
